Is Lp(a) Actually Dangerous? The Missing Context

The conversation delves into the misunderstood nature of LP little a, the panic and fear surrounding it, the nuanced biological roles of LP little a, the lack of definitive human outcome trials, the structural complexity of LP little a, the influence of genetics on LP little a, and the practical implications of LP little a results. Kidneys Aren't Just Plumbing: Here's What They Really Do

The conversation delves into the multifaceted role of kidneys, extending beyond urine production to encompass blood pressure control, fluid balance, and biochemical administration. It highlights the challenges in kidney function testing, the significance of urine testing, and the symptoms and indicators of kidney health. Additionally, it emphasizes the impact of type 2 diabetes, diet, and the need for a comprehensive approach to kidney health.
